National Drive-In Movie Day commemorates the day in 1933 when the first drive-in theater in the United States opened. Goleta`s own Airport Drive-In opened in April of 1951 with room for 700 cars, and was first listed at 6201 Hollister Avenue. The address was later changed to 400 Frederick Lopez Road.
Now closed, the lot is currently used for airport parking, although the entrance gateway and ticketbooths remain.
